A Day in Coorg - August 22, 2023

9:00AM: Madikeri Fort

Start your day exploring Madikeri Fort, a historical landmark that offers panoramic views of the surrounding hills. Built in the 17th century, the fort houses a museum displaying weapons, artifacts, and photographs from the past (Entry fee: INR 25 per person, 1-2 hours).

11:30AM: Raja's Seat

Head to Raja's Seat, a beautiful garden located on a hilltop. Enjoy the breathtaking views of the mist-covered valleys and watch the sunrise over the mountains. This scenic spot was once the favorite relaxation spot for the kings of Coorg (Entry fee: INR 5 per person, 1 hour).

1:00PM: Lunch at East End Hotel

Indulge in a delicious lunch at East End Hotel, a popular restaurant known for its authentic Coorgi cuisine. Try the flavorful pork curry, pandi curry, or the traditional bamboo shoot curry with steamed rice (Estimated cost: INR 400 per person, 1 hour).

2:30PM: Abbey Falls

Visit Abbey Falls, a stunning waterfall surrounded by lush greenery. Take a short trek through the coffee plantations to reach the falls and admire its cascading beauty. This picturesque spot is a must-visit for nature lovers (Entry fee: INR 15 per person, 1-2 hours).

4:30PM: Namdroling Monastery

Explore the Namdroling Monastery, also known as the Golden Temple. Admire the intricate Tibetan architecture, colorful murals, and the serene atmosphere of this Buddhist monastery. Witness the monks chanting their prayers and immerse yourself in the peaceful ambiance (Free admission, 1-2 hours).

6:30PM: Sunset at Mandalpatti Viewpoint

End your day with a mesmerizing sunset at Mandalpatti Viewpoint. Take a thrilling jeep ride to reach the viewpoint and witness the breathtaking panoramic views of the surrounding hills and valleys. Capture the golden hues of the sunset and create memories to last a lifetime (Entry fee: INR 25 per person, Jeep ride cost: INR 1,000 per jeep, 2-3 hours).

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, visit Chelavara Falls, a serene waterfall tucked away in the Western Ghats. It requires a short trek, but the picturesque surroundings and the tranquility of the falls make it worth the effort. Locals also love exploring the coffee plantations of Coorg, where you can learn about the coffee-making process and even indulge in a coffee tasting session. Don't forget to try the locally produced honey and spices.
